每个应用程序,无论大小,最终都需要一个数据库来持久保存所有重要数据。对此没有任何争论!
什么是数据库设计?
数据库设计是帮助创建、实施和维护企业数据管理系统的一系列步骤的集合。设计数据库的主要目的是为所建议的数据库系统生成物理和逻辑设计模型。
什么是关系数据库?
关系数据库是以预定义的方式存储彼此相关的数据的一种方式。通过预定义,我们的意思是在创建数据库时,您可以识别不同实体或数据组之间存在的关系。关系数据库非常适合存储结构化数据,这些数据应该对现实生活中的实体之间的关系进行建模。
关系数据库的剖析:
表:表示按行列组织的实体的数据。
属性:要存储的有关实体的属性。
关系:表之间的关系。
索引:用于连接表和进行快速查找。
关系数据库由两个或多个表组成,这些表的行数和列数可变。表对于它们所表示的实体是唯一的。每一列表示与表中每一行关联的一个特定属性,这些行是存储在该表中的实际记录。为了说明关系数据库的魔力,我们将为想要管理其产品、客户、订单和员工的零售商设计一个数据库。
如何设计数据库?
数据具有一致的格式
所有记录条目都有一个唯一的主键
您不会遗漏重要数据
下一步是什么?
这种繁琐的事宜中,我们需要一个工具来帮助我们设计数据库。
itBuilder是一款在线表结构设计软件,借助人工智能提高效率,可以生成CRUD代码并推送至开发工具中,涵盖几乎所有语言,如Java、Python、JavaScript等,通过插件自动将代码同步到您的开发工具中,省去繁琐的体力劳动,将精力集中在更关键的地方,并且支持团队多人协作,实时通信,无缝协作。
这并不是itBuilder所有的功能,更多功能需要您去探索!!!